2. What Are Cookies?

Cookies are small text files that are placed on your computer, smartphone, tablet, or other internet-connected device when you visit a website. They are widely used by website owners to make websites work more efficiently, to improve the user experience, and to provide information to the owners of the website.

Cookies are created by your web browser and stored on your device at the request of websites you visit. Each cookie contains a small amount of data, which can include an anonymous unique identifier. Cookies are sent back to the originating website on each subsequent visit, or to another website that recognizes that cookie.

Cookies serve many different purposes. Some are necessary for the technical operation of a website (for example, to keep you logged in as you navigate between pages), while others help website owners understand how visitors interact with their website, or enable the display of personalized advertising.

In addition to traditional cookies, we may also use similar tracking technologies such as:

  • Web Beacons (Pixel Tags): Tiny invisible images embedded in web pages or emails that track whether a page or email has been opened.
  • Local Storage: A browser feature that allows websites to store data locally on your device, functioning similarly to cookies.
  • Session Storage: Temporary data storage that is cleared when your browser session ends.
  • Fingerprinting: A technique that collects information about your browser and device to create a unique identifier.

For the purposes of this Cookie Policy, all such technologies are collectively referred to as "cookies."

3. How Do Cookies Work?

When you first visit pizza-via313.digital, our web server sends a cookie to your browser, which stores it as a small file on your device. The next time you visit our site, your browser reads the cookie and sends the information back to our server. This allows our website to recognize your browser and remember information about your previous visit, such as your language preferences or the items you added to your cart.

Cookies can be categorized based on who sets them and how long they last:

  • First-Party Cookies: Set directly by Via 313 (pizza-via313.digital) for our own purposes.
  • Third-Party Cookies: Set by external services that we use, such as Google Analytics or advertising networks.
  • Session Cookies: Temporary cookies that are deleted from your device when you close your browser.
  • Persistent Cookies: Cookies that remain on your device for a set period of time or until you delete them manually.

5. Specific Cookies We Use

The table below provides detailed information about the specific cookies used on pizza-via313.digital, including their names, purposes, types, and durations.

Cookie Name Provider Purpose Type Duration
_ga Google Analytics Registers a unique ID to generate statistical data on how the visitor uses the website. Used to distinguish users and track sessions across the site. Analytics 2 years
_gid Google Analytics Registers a unique ID that is used to generate statistical data on how the visitor uses the website. This cookie stores and updates a unique value for each page visited. Analytics 24 hours
_gat Google Analytics Used by Google Analytics to throttle request rates. Limits the collection of data on high-traffic websites to manage data load on Google's servers. Analytics 1 minute
_gcl_au Google Ads Used by Google AdSense for experimenting with advertisement efficiency across websites using their services. Tracks ad conversions and links clicks on Google Ads to actions taken on the website. Advertising 90 days
_fbp Facebook / Meta Used by Facebook to deliver a series of advertisement products such as real-time bidding from third-party advertisers. Tracks visits across websites and links them to Facebook advertising campaigns. Advertising 90 days
cookieconsent_status pizza-via313.digital Stores the user's cookie consent preference so that the cookie consent banner does not appear on every page visit. Essential 1 year
session_id pizza-via313.digital Maintains the user's session state across page requests. Required for the website's online ordering system to function correctly. Essential Session
cart_token pizza-via313.digital Stores information about the items added to the user's online food order cart, allowing the cart to persist across pages and browser sessions. Functional 7 days
preferred_location pizza-via313.digital Remembers the user's preferred Via 313 restaurant location to pre-populate location-based ordering and content on future visits. Functional 30 days
user_preferences pizza-via313.digital Stores user preferences such as dietary filters (vegetarian, gluten-free options) and display settings to provide a personalized browsing experience. Functional 6 months
_ga_[ID] Google Analytics 4 Used to persist session state for Google Analytics 4. Collects information about how users interact with the website including page views, events, and ecommerce transactions. Analytics 2 years
CSRF-TOKEN pizza-via313.digital A security cookie that helps protect against Cross-Site Request Forgery (CSRF) attacks by verifying that form submissions originate from our website. Essential Session

9. Your Privacy Rights Under US Law

Depending on your state of residence, you may have certain rights regarding your personal data, including data collected through cookies. Under the California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A) and the California Privacy Rights Act (CPRA), California residents have the following rights:

  • Right to Know: The right to know what personal information we collect, use, disclose, and sell about you.
  • Right to Delete: The right to request deletion of personal information we have collected from you, subject to certain exceptions.
  • Right to Opt-Out of Sale or Sharing: The right to opt out of the sale or sharing of your personal information to third parties.
  • Right to Correct: The right to request correction of inaccurate personal information.
  • Right to Limit Use of Sensitive Personal Information: The right to limit the use and disclosure of sensitive personal information.
  • Right to Non-Discrimination: The right not to receive discriminatory treatment for exercising your privacy rights.

Cookies used for analytics and advertising purposes may constitute the "sale" or "sharing" of personal information under the CCPA/CPRA.
